Спецификации
| Атрибут | Ценность |
| Supplier | Skyworks Solutions Inc. |
| Package | Tape & Reel (TR),Cut Tape (CT) |
| ProductStatus | Obsolete |
| Frequency | 250MHz ~ 2.7GHz |
| P1dB | 24dBm |
| Gain | 22dB |
| NoiseFigure | 4dB |
| RFType | GSM, DCS, PCS |
| Voltage-Supply | 3V, 5V |
| Current-Supply | 160mA |
| TestFrequency | 900MHz |
| MountingType | Surface Mount |
| Package/Case | 3-SMD Module |

Pinout
1. Pin 1 (RF In): This is the RF input pin, where the signal to be amplified is fed into the amplifier.
2. Pin 2 (GND): This pin is the ground connection and is used for grounding the device, providing a reference point for the input and output signals.
3. Pin 3 (RF Out/VCC): This pin serves a dual purpose. It acts as the RF output where the amplified signal is delivered, and it also serves as the power supply pin (VCC), providing the necessary DC voltage for the operation of the amplifier.
